Dear Dr. Khalid,

I am writing to express my enthusiasm for the Oceanographer position at Alexandria University, a prestigious institution located in the vibrant coastal city of Egypt Alexandria. As a dedicated oceanographer with over a decade of experience in marine science and coastal ecosystem studies, I am eager to contribute my expertise to advance research initiatives that align with Egypt’s critical role in Mediterranean Sea conservation and sustainable development. The opportunity to work within this dynamic academic environment, where the confluence of history, culture, and scientific inquiry shapes innovation, deeply resonates with my professional aspirations.

Egypt Alexandria is not merely a geographical location for me—it is a hub of marine research and cultural heritage. The city’s strategic position along the Mediterranean Sea offers unique opportunities to study the interplay between human activity, climate change, and marine biodiversity. As an oceanographer, I am particularly drawn to Alexandria’s role as a gateway to understanding the ecological dynamics of the eastern Mediterranean. The Nile Delta’s influence on coastal ecosystems and Alexandria’s historical significance as a maritime center make this region a critical area for interdisciplinary research. I am committed to leveraging my skills in oceanographic analysis, remote sensing, and environmental modeling to address challenges such as rising sea levels, marine pollution, and the preservation of Egypt’s marine heritage.

My academic journey began with a Bachelor’s degree in Marine Biology from the University of Southampton, followed by a Master’s in Oceanography from the Scripps Institution of Oceanography. I completed my Ph.D. at the University of Bremen, focusing on the impact of climate change on Mediterranean marine ecosystems. Over the past 12 years, I have worked as a research oceanographer at various institutions, including the National Oceanic and Atmospheric Administration (NOAA) and the European Space Agency (ESA). My work has centered on satellite-based monitoring of coastal zones, biogeochemical cycles, and the development of predictive models for marine environmental change.

At NOAA, I led a project analyzing microplastic accumulation in coastal waters along the U.S. East Coast, which resulted in a publication in *Marine Pollution Bulletin* and informed policy recommendations for waste management. At ESA, I contributed to the Sentinel-3 satellite mission, developing algorithms to measure sea surface temperature and chlorophyll concentration. These experiences have honed my ability to integrate fieldwork with advanced data analysis, a skill set I believe is vital for addressing the complex challenges facing Egypt’s marine environment.
